Karnataka Cabinet Grants Alipur Town Panchayat Status, Marking a New Era of Urban Development
Chief Minister Siddaramaiah’s cabinet has officially approved the upgrade of Alipur Gram Panchayat to Pattana (Town) Panchayat status. This historic decision was taken during the cabinet meeting on Thursday, July 24, 2025, transforming Alipur from a gram panchayat into a town panchayat, recognizing its urban characteristics and substantial development.
The Catalyst for Change the upgrade followed a direct appeal by MLA K.H. Puttaswamy Gowda to Chief Minister Siddaramaiah during a public event in Gauribidanur. The CM’s immediate endorsement – “Let’s make it a Town Panchayat” – set in motion a swift administrative process, culminating in last week’s cabinet approval.
The shift from village to town panchayat formally recognizes Alipur’s vibrant development, with its thriving economy, modern infrastructure, and rich cultural identity. Once known as a rural enclave, Alipur now boasts 297 streets and 3,194 buildings including homes, shops, masjids, ashoorkhanas, and educational institutions spread across 6.65km² at GPS coordinates 13.489170701434741, 77.4586559013672.

Administrative and Developmental Benefits
-
Enhanced Local Governance: Alipur will be governed by a Pattana Panchayat council with elected representatives and a dedicated executive officer.
-
Access to Urban Infrastructure Funding: The town is now eligible for government grants and development schemes reserved for urban local bodies, enabling projects in water supply, lighting, waste management, and public facilities.
-
Urban Planning and Regulation: Building permissions, business licensing, and public amenities will be managed locally, streamlining services and planning for sustainable growth.
-
Economic and Social Growth: The upgrade also brings opportunities for local businesses, education, and community welfare through improved administrative frameworks and civic amenities.
